When leaders consider modernizing their systems, one of the first questions they ask is, “How long will this take?” The answer isn’t the same for everyone. But there are predictable factors that determine the timeline.
Understanding these variables can help you set realistic expectations, manage budgets, and avoid project fatigue.

Step 1: Define the Scope
The size and complexity of your modernization effort will be the most significant factor in how long it takes.
- Small scope: Updating a handful of systems or replacing a single platform can often be completed in 4–8 weeks.
- Medium scope: Multi-system upgrades with compliance integration typically take 3–6 months.
- Enormous scope: Full infrastructure overhauls or enterprise-wide modernization may take 9–18 months.
Tip: The more clearly you define the scope at the start, the more accurate your timeline will be.
Step 2: Factor in Compliance Requirements
Compliance work adds time if you’re in the defense sector or another regulated industry. Compliance is non-negotiable.
- Building compliance documentation alongside modernization prevents costly rework later.
- Mapping modernization steps to frameworks like CMMC, NIST, or ISO can extend timelines by weeks or months, depending on gaps found.
Step 3: Account for Procurement and Vendor Lead Times
Hardware, software licenses, and external services all have delivery timelines.
Even in the best conditions, supply chain delays can add weeks.
Mitigation strategies include:
- Pre-ordering high-demand hardware early in the project
- Choosing vendors with proven on-time delivery
- Keeping contingency solutions ready in case of delays
Step 4: Plan for Training and Adoption
Technology upgrades don’t end when the new system is installed.
User adoption is critical, and training takes time.
- Schedule training sessions before the switchover.
- Allow for a transition period where both old and new systems are available.
- Assemble in time for feedback and process adjustments.
Step 5: Expect the Unexpected
Even with strong planning, things happen. Common delays include:
- Unforeseen compatibility issues
- Last-minute compliance updates
- Unplanned operational priorities
Plan buffer time into your schedule so one issue doesn’t derail the entire project.
Typical Timeline Ranges

Why Timelines Matter
Unrealistic timelines cause rushed decisions, overlooked compliance needs, and missed cost optimization opportunities.
Knowing the real-time commitment up front makes it easier to:
- Sequence modernization with operational cycles
- Keep budgets in line
- Maintain team morale over the project’s duration
Take the First Step
Our Tech Modernization Checklist helps you define the scope, compliance plan, and build a realistic modernization timeline.

Download the checklist now and plan your modernization with clarity and confidence.